The 2016 movie, The Legend of Tarzan, wasn't just another remake; it was a reimagining, a fresh take on the classic story, and it brought together a stellar cast to make it happen. From the vine-swinging hero to the treacherous villains, the actors in this movie truly embodied their roles, captivating audiences and transporting them to the lush, green landscapes of the Congo. This film wasn't just about Tarzan's return to civilization; it was about his struggle to reconcile his past with his present, all while protecting his family and fighting for what he believes in. The 2016 version had a unique premise, which set it apart. The story begins with Tarzan, now John Clayton III, living in Victorian England with his beloved Jane. He's called back to the Congo as an envoy of Parliament, unaware that he is a pawn in a deadly plot orchestrated by the nefarious Captain Leon Rom. The narrative blends action, adventure, and a touch of romance, making it a compelling watch for audiences of all ages. Samuel L. Jackson as George Washington Williams

And how about the legendary Samuel L. Jackson as George Washington Williams? Jackson, as usual, brought his charisma and wit to the role of a real-life historical figure. Williams was a former soldier and adventurer who accompanied Tarzan on his journey back to the Congo. His character provided a much-needed dose of humor and a moral compass. Williams was a voice of reason in the chaos, adding depth to the narrative. Jackson's portrayal was not just about entertainment; he shed light on the themes of colonialism and the fight for freedom. His character provided a critical viewpoint on the events unfolding in the Congo. His character's role in the story made for a great adventure, and Jackson did an amazing job.
